What is the Respiratory Virus Season Vaccination Declination Form?

The Respiratory Virus Season Vaccination Declination Form is a critical document for healthcare workers who choose to decline COVID-19 and flu vaccinations. This form helps manage personal and employment information, ensuring that all necessary data is collected for organizational records.
This form serves multiple purposes, including documenting a healthcare worker's decision regarding vaccinations and facilitating compliance with health protocols. It is essential for protecting both individual rights and public health.

Purpose and Benefits of Declining Vaccination

The use of the declination form allows healthcare workers to formally document their choice to decline vaccination. However, declining vaccinations can have significant risks, including exposure to increased isolation mandates and formal mask-wearing requirements in healthcare settings.
By utilizing the Vaccination Declination Form, healthcare facilities maintain accurate records and comply with organizational policies. This can also protect workers from potential repercussions related to vaccination status.

Key Features of the Respiratory Virus Season Vaccination Declination

The Respiratory Virus Season Vaccination Declination Form includes essential fields for personal information and checkboxes for selecting applicable reasons for declining vaccinations. Clear instructions guide users in completing the form correctly.
Signing the form is crucial for validation, marking the official acknowledgment of the decision to decline vaccination. This element reinforces the form's legitimacy within healthcare systems.

Who Needs the Respiratory Virus Season Vaccination Declination?

Healthcare workers eligible to fill out this declination form include those in patient-facing roles and employees within healthcare environments. Compliance is vital, as many organizations require documentation of vaccination status from their staff.
Specific groups that may be affected include frontline healthcare workers, those with medical or religious exemptions, and employees in high-risk facilities. Understanding who needs this form can streamline adherence to safety protocols.
